要在云服务器上安装PHP环境,通常可以选择使用包管理器或者手动编译安装。以下是在基于Linux的云服务器上安装PHP环境的步骤:
使用包管理器安装(以Ubuntu为例)
- 更新包列表
- 更新包列表
- 安装PHP及其扩展
- 安装PHP及其扩展
- 验证安装
- 验证安装
使用手动编译安装
- 安装依赖
- 安装依赖
- 下载PHP源码
- 下载PHP源码
- 配置编译选项
- 配置编译选项
- 编译并安装
- 编译并安装
- 配置PHP
复制配置文件并进行必要的修改:
- 配置PHP
复制配置文件并进行必要的修改:
- 启动PHP-FPM
- 启动PHP-FPM
应用场景
- Web开发:PHP广泛用于构建动态网站和Web应用程序。
- API开发:可以快速搭建RESTful API服务。
- 内容管理系统(CMS):如WordPress、Drupal等都是基于PHP开发的。
优势
- 丰富的库支持:PHP拥有大量的扩展和库,便于快速开发。
- 跨平台:可以在多种操作系统上运行。
- 社区支持:庞大的开发者社区提供了丰富的资源和支持。
常见问题及解决方法
问题:PHP无法连接到MySQL数据库
原因:可能是MySQL扩展未安装或配置不正确。
解决方法:
- 确保安装了
php-mysql
扩展: - 确保安装了
php-mysql
扩展: - 重启Web服务器(如Apache):
- 重启Web服务器(如Apache):
通过以上步骤,你应该能够在云服务器上成功安装并配置PHP环境。如果遇到其他问题,建议查看错误日志以获取更多信息。